// Fixture: restock planner for the Cogsworth vending fleet.
// Seeds three machines with mixed inventory so plugins can
// verify route ordering and low-stock thresholds. Planner
// output is deterministic given this seed. Plugins calling
// the staging planner API must authenticate on every request,
// so use the bearer token provided below:

portal login ticket: eyJhbGciOiJIUzI1NiIsInR5cCI6IkpXVCJ9.eyJzdWIiOiIwEOsktwVNwIn0.-UJU3fdyyCgG

Action item (from the Gullwing outage review): per-tenant rate quotas were uniform, so one tenant's burst starved the rest. We're moving to tiered quotas with a shared overflow pool, owned by the platform team, due next sprint. Enforcement happens at the Kestrel gateway; rejected requests get a retry-after hint. Proposed initial values for discussion at the sync are as follows:

tuning table, kajog-bawip:
TIERS = {
    "kelius": 256,
    "lammir": 543,
}

Internal Memo — Project Larkspur Delay

To: Heads of Department, Fennick Industrial

Project Larkspur's rollout slips eight weeks due to integration failures in the Coppermill test environment. Vendor remediation is underway; revised milestones follow next Friday. Budget impact is contained within existing contingency, though Q4 reporting timelines tighten accordingly. Please brief your teams on the delay only, noting the confidential item below.

board note of baduf-bawig: Gilethax Systems plans to lower the Normir list price by 33.5 percent in August. The steering committee signed off on a budget of $262.4 million for Project Pelox. The renewal with Wenokek Holdings closes at $446.0 million a year, 64.8 percent below the last contract. Project Tamvan slips by six weeks because of the tooling delay.